  • Long-Term Preservation of Digital Information in China: Some Problems and Solutions Liu, Jiazhen Du, Peng Information Management Foreign Countries Local Government Electronic Publishing Access to Information Information Systems Information Storage Electronic Libraries Purpose: The purpose of this paper to describe the research work on the long-term preservation of Chinese digital information funded by National Natural Science Foundation of China (NSFC) since 2001. Design/methodology/approach: The paper provides an overview, in text and figures, of ways in which e-documents originating in China, in now obsolete formats, can be made readable again. Also, results of a recent survey of electronic records management in government and corporations are given. Findings: The lifecycle management gap with respect to electronic records is highlighted and the main factors that restrict the Chinese anti-disaster data backup plan are analysed. It is suggested that the data backup centre which can be accepted by small medium enterprises should be the e-government disaster recovery centre for local government. Originality/value: All the research results are useful for those who need to understand the long-term preservation of Chinese digital information and electronic records management.
